  1. **How to Make Lime and Cotija Corn: A Flavorful Mexican Street Food Delight**
  2. Lime and Cotija corn, also known as *Elote*, is a popular Mexican street food that combines the sweetness of corn with tangy lime, creamy Cotija cheese, and a hint of spice. This dish is perfect for summer barbecues, potlucks, or as a side dish for any meal. Follow these detailed steps to create this mouthwatering recipe at home.
  3. ---
  4. ### **Ingredients** (Serves 4)
  5. - 4 ears of fresh corn, husks removed
  6. - 1/4 cup mayonnaise (or Mexican crema for authenticity)
  7. - 1/2 cup crumbled Cotija cheese
  8. - 1 lime, cut into wedges
  9. - 1 teaspoon chili powder (adjust to taste)
  10. - 1/4 teaspoon smoked paprika (optional)
  11. - 1/4 cup chopped fresh cilantro (optional)
  12. - Salt and pepper to taste
  13. ---
  14. ### **Step-by-Step Instructions**
  15. #### **1. Prepare the Corn**
  16. - **Grill or Boil the Corn**: Preheat your grill to medium-high heat or b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. If grilling, place the corn directly on the grates and cook for 10-12 minutes, turning occasionally, until charred and tender. If boiling, cook the corn for 5-7 minutes until tender.

  18. #### **2. Coat the Corn with Mayonnaise**
  19. - Once the corn is cooked, let it cool slightly. Using a brush or spoon, generously coat each ear of corn with mayonnaise or Mexican crema. This creates a creamy base for the toppings to stick to.

  21. #### **3. Add Cotija Cheese**
  22. - Sprinkle crumbled Cotija cheese evenly over the mayonnaise-coated corn. Cotija cheese is salty and crumbly, adding a rich, savory flavor to the dish.

  24. #### **4. Squeeze Fresh Lime Juice**
  25. - Squeeze fresh lime juice over the corn to add a bright, tangy flavor. The acidity of the lime balances the richness of the cheese and mayonnaise.

  27. #### **5. Season with Spices**
  28. - Sprinkle chili powder and smoked paprika over the corn for a smoky, slightly spicy kick. Adjust the amount of chili powder based on your heat preference.

  30. #### **6. Garnish and Serve**
  31. - For added freshness, sprinkle chopped cilantro over the corn. Serve immediately with extra lime wedges on the side for an extra burst of flavor.

  34. ### **Tips for Perfect Lime and Cotija Corn**
  35. - **Use Fresh Ingredients**: Fresh corn, lime, and Cotija cheese make a significant difference in flavor.
  36. - **Customize Toppings**: Add hot sauce, garlic powder, or Tajín seasoning for extra flavor.
  37. - **Serve Warm**: This dish is best enjoyed warm, so serve it right after preparation.
